
Top 50 Largest Countries In The World 2025#shorts#viralshorts#shortvideo#country#russia#top10#edit
Top 50 Largest Countries In The World 2025#shorts#viralshorts#shortvideo#country#russia#top10#edit #russia #india #china #unitedstates #southafrica #australia #newzealand